Few playoff battles in junior hockey generate the buzz and atmosphere of London-Kitchener. So while attendance is down across the board in the first round of the Ontario Hockey League’s delayed postseason, rows of empty seats through the opening week of action are most noticeable and jarring at Budweiser Gardens and the venerable Memorial Auditorium. Game 4: Rookie Kitchener goalie stymies Knights in 52-save stunner

KITCHENER – The London Knights have a Jackson Parsons problem. The rookie Kitchener Rangers goaltender stopped a mind-boggling 52 shots in his first playoff start and outdueled London counterpart Brett Brochu in a series-tying 3-2 Game 4 victory before 3,644 Tuesday at the Memorial Auditorium.
